\begin{align*} y^{\prime \prime }+9 y&=2 \sec \left (3 x \right ) \end{align*}

Solution by Maple

Time used: 0.001 (sec). Leaf size: 33

dsolve(diff(y(x),x$2)+9*y(x)=2*sec(3*x),y(x), singsol=all)
 
\[ y = -\frac {2 \ln \left (\sec \left (3 x \right )\right ) \cos \left (3 x \right )}{9}+\cos \left (3 x \right ) c_1 +\frac {2 \sin \left (3 x \right ) \left (x +\frac {3 c_2}{2}\right )}{3} \]

Solution by Mathematica

Time used: 0.033 (sec). Leaf size: 39

DSolve[D[y[x],{x,2}]+9*y[x]==2*Sec[3*x],y[x],x,IncludeSingularSolutions -> True]
 
\[ y(x)\to \frac {1}{3} (2 x+3 c_2) \sin (3 x)+\cos (3 x) \left (\frac {2}{9} \log (\cos (3 x))+c_1\right ) \]
